✍ M.F.A. AZEEZ; A.F. VAKAKIS πŸ“‚ Article πŸ“… 2001 πŸ› Elsevier Science 🌐 English βš– 684 KB

This study employs the method of proper orthogonal decomposition (POD), also known as the Karhunen}Loeve (K}L) method, to extract dominant coherent structures (modes that approximate the system behavior) from time-series data.
